Dick Oatts is a human[1]. He was born in Des Moines[2]. He was born on January 1, 1953[3]. He worked as a jazz saxophonist[4] and university teacher[5]. He ranks in the top 0.73% of human entities by monthly Wikipedia readership (20 views/month, #7,281 of 1,000,298).[6]

Career and Affiliations
Recorded occupations include jazz saxophonist[4] and university teacher[5]. Employers include Manhattan School of Music[8], a conservatory[26], in United States[27], founded in 1917[28] and Temple University[9], a university[29], in United States[30], founded in 1884[31]. A notable student of Dick Oatts was Tineke Postma[10].
